Industrial Electrician / Maintenance Technician
Job summary
The Industrial Electrician / Maintenance Technician is responsible for installing, ma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ing electrical systems, machinery, and industrial equipment to ensure safe and efficient operations. The role involves conducting preventive and corrective maintenance, diagnosing electrical and mechanical faults, replacing faulty components, and responding promptly to equipment breakdowns. The technician also performs routine inspections, maintains maintenance records, follows electrical and workplace safety standards, and supports continuous improvement initiatives to minimise equipment downtime and maintain reliable production operations.

Key Responsibilities
- Maintain and troubleshoot PLC-based electrical control systems.
- Diagnose and repair electrical faults during live factory operations.
- Maintain and troubleshoot:
- Contactors, relays, overloads, and MCC panels.
- Motors, inverters/VFDs, sensors, and control panels.
- Factory electrical wiring and related electrical installations.
- Carry out preventive and corrective electrical maintenance activities.
- Respond promptly to equipment breakdowns and minimise production downtime.
- Support the maintenance team in ensuring the reliability and availability of production equipment.
- Follow all applicable electrical safety procedures and company safety requirements.
- Work effectively within a 24-hour continuous production and shift environment.
